Accessibility standards
Figshare is committed to becoming WCAG compliant and ensuring that the platform is usable for all users. We recognise the importance of providing an inclusive experience for all users and are committed to making continued accessibility improvements across the system until we are conformant with WCAG 2.2 Level A and AA.
We assess Figshare’s accessibility against the following conformance criteria:
- WCAG 2.2 AA
- European accessibility standard EN 301 549
- Section 508
Figshare has a mix of compliance levels across WCAG 2.2 criteria, with the majority of criteria being ‘Supported’ or ‘Partially supported’. Figshare meets most WCAG 2.2 Level A requirements and is working to upgrade the system to meet a greater number of Level A Level AA criteria.
There are a small number of pages that are supported by older technology and do not meet all Level A requirements. We have updates planned to the underlying technology on these pages which will allow for improved keyboard navigation, ‘reflow’, and more comprehensive programmatic labelling for screenreaders.

User generated content
The Figshare platform enables users to upload and share a wide variety of content and files. While we strive for overall accessibility, please be aware that user-generated content is not directly under our control. We are committed to empowering our users to create accessible content and are actively developing tools and resources to facilitate this.

Updates and changes
We are dedicated to fostering an inclusive environment for all users and are continuously working to improve the accessibility of the Figshare platform. Accessibility is considered during the development of any new features and upgrades to existing pages. We also include screenreader and keyboard navigation tests as part of our standard testing process. Updates or changes to accessibility as a result of page upgrades will be reflected as we update our WCAG 2.2 VPAT®.
